Barto Gold is a privately owned Australian gold explorer, developer, and producer who has been operating since 2009 and is focused on gold exploration and production in Western Australia. Its flagship project is located at Marvel Loch in Western Australia, operating multiple open pits and an underground mine, which services a 2.1Mt per annum name plate processing facility. These are supported by a tenement holding of greater than 1,400km2 over the prospective Southern Cross Greenstone Belt only 4 and a half hours from Perth.
Significant project investment to date has resulted in the company being well positioned, developing its multiple >5-year mine life underground mines, in conjunction with continuing to produce from its open pit operations. Currently the company operates two producing undergrounds with another new operation being rehabilitated and three open pits balanced against each other.
